(LG Mobile Phones) today announced that the highly anticipated Glimmer(TM) by LG will be exclusively available in Alltel retail stores and online at shopalltel.com beginning tomorrow, March 13. With a slide-out keypad and touch-screen interface, the LG Glimmer incorporates traditional phone functions with the latest multimedia features. This slick phone is rich with several of Alltel's Axcess applications including Alltel Navigation, Axcess Search, CityID and Axcess TV. In addition, users can listen to their favorite music while utilizing other multimedia features on the phone, such as taking photos, recording video or sending text messages. The Glimmer also features 3D graphics support and 128MB of internal memory. "With touch-screen phones revolutionizing wireless, the LG Glimmer from Alltel has an innovative new touch interface while offering the convenience of a slide-out physical keypad," states Brian Ullem, vice president of device strategy for Alltel Wireless. "Its large display and multimedia capabilities allow our customers to access and manage their video and music with a simple touch." "Consumers will appreciate the durable metal body of this elegant, user-friendly mobile phone," said Ehtisham Rabbani, vice president of product strategy & marketing at LG Mobile Phones. "With its slim form factor and large sliding touch screen the Glimmer by LG is another example of forward-thinking technology and design." Alltel Wireless is offering the Glimmer by LG for $249.99 after a $100 mail-in-rebate. This discounted price is available to new customers who sign-up for a two-year service agreement and to existing eligible customers on qualifying rate plans. All Alltel customers who purchase the LG Glimmer and are on a qualifying rate plan are able to receive "My Circle," Alltel's exclusive calling feature allowing customers to receive unlimited calling to any five, 10 or 20 numbers, any network. In addition, Alltel was the first to offer Anytime Plan Changes, giving customers the flexibility to change their calling plans at any time, without extending their current contract.
